Abstract

The invention discloses an anti-blocking device of a transanal intestinal obstruction catheter, which comprises a catheter body, one end of the catheter body is communicated with a suction tube, the outer end of the suction tube is communicated with a Y-shaped catheter connector, the outer end of the catheter body is provided with an anti-blocking dredging device used for dredging catheter blockage, any outer end of the Y-shaped catheter connector is connected with an automatic water injection assembly used for cleaning the catheter, the catheter body can be dredged through the anti-blocking dredging device, the blockage condition in the catheter body can be detected, whether blockage of the catheter body is removed or not is effectively judged, compared with manual bending and extruding of the catheter by personnel, the labor capacity of the personnel is greatly reduced, meanwhile, blockage removal judgment is more accurate, use by the personnel is facilitated, and smooth proceeding of medicine perfusion and drainage is guaranteed.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of anorectal catheters, in particular to an anti-blocking device for transanal intestinal obstruction catheters. Background technique [0002] The transanal intestinal obstruction catheter is an indispensable catheter for improving and relieving intestinal obstruction by conservative treatment for patients with intestinal obstruction who do not undergo surgical treatment. Due to the difficulty of placing the catheter, it is difficult to place the catheter again after blockage. The tube is difficult and brings pain to the patient. In addition, the diameter of the anal-type intestinal catheter is not thick, so the intestinal feces and the like are easy to cause blockage, and the drainage, exhaust and drug irrigation are not used to proceed smoothly, thus affecting the therapeutic effect.
